Moving container costs from Salt Lake City, UT to Colorado Springs, CO
Moving containers from Salt Lake City, Utah, to Colorado Springs, Colorado, cost between $1,078 and $3,403. A container is delivered to your home and you load it on your own time. Loading windows vary by company: U-Haul gives you 3 days and PODS gives you 30. From there, the company takes over and transports it to Colorado Springs. If you go over that window, storage in Salt Lake City adds around $70/month.

What other costs come with moving containers?
- Moving labor: Because loading is on you with a container move, hourly labor help is a popular add-on. In Salt Lake City, UT, two movers for roughly five hours costs around $816, according to moveBuddha data. Compare the best labor-only movers nationwide
- Storage: After the first month, ongoing rental fees kick in. A small container (7 - 8 feet) averages about $87 per month, while a 12- to 16-foot unit runs around $175 per month.
- Access: Most major container companies serve both Salt Lake City, UT, and Colorado Springs, CO, but confirm a facility is within reasonable distance if you need to retrieve items while in storage.
- Added contents protection: Full-value protection provides broader coverage than the standard liability in your contract. It typically costs 1% - 2% of your declared shipment value, about $500 - $1,000 on $50,000 worth of belongings.

Pro tip: The base rate of $449 - $1,250 is just the starting point for a rental truck move from Salt Lake City to Colorado Springs. Fuel ($218 - $249) , lodging at around $175/night, meals, and equipment rentals are all on top of that. Factor in an extra $600 - $1,200 to get a realistic picture of what the move will actually cost.
What other costs come with rental trucks?
- Additional insurance: Supplemental coverage typically averages around $30 per day.
- Lodging: Budget around $175 per night if your drive requires an overnight stop. Typically, you'll make 1 - 3 overnight stops, depending on move distance.
- Moving labor: Bringing in professional loading help in Salt Lake City, Utah, usually costs about $816 for 2 movers and 5 hours of labor.
- Gas: Fuel for the 588-mile drive falls between $218 and $249, depending on whether your truck runs on gas or diesel.
- Equipment: Appliance dollies, moving pads, and vehicle trailers are easy to overlook but can add between $58 and $350 to your total.

Freight trailer costs from Salt Lake City, UT to Colorado Springs, CO
Freight trailers are a good fit for medium-to-large moves where you need more space than a container but don't want to drive a rental truck from Salt Lake City, Utah, to Colorado Springs, Colorado. The trailer is delivered to your address, you load it, and the carrier takes it the rest of the way.
Unlike truck rentals with flat rates, freight trailers scale with your shipment. Every additional section of trailer space you fill increases your total. Most long-distance moves using this method run roughly between $1,074 and $1,985.

Pro tip: Freight trailers offer generous space but reward good packing strategy. The 4-foot ramp can be challenging for large or heavy pieces, and using the full 8-foot height takes careful stacking. Because you're billed by the linear foot, maximizing vertical space keeps your costs lower.
What other costs come with freight trailers?
- Moving labor: Freight trailers don't include loading help. In Salt Lake City, Utah, hiring 2 movers for about 5 hours typically costs $816.
- More space: You only pay for the trailer footage you use, but underestimating your load can add roughly $87 - $175 per additional foot to your total.
- Time of year: Rates tend to climb during peak moving season (mid-May through mid-September) when trailer demand is at its highest.

How long does a move from Salt Lake City, UT to Colorado Springs, CO take?
Full-service movers and container companies typically complete this route in 5 - 7 days, since carriers consolidate shipments heading the same direction. Freight trailers are usually the fastest option outside of driving yourself, with deliveries in 3 - 5 days, though you'll need to be ready to receive your shipment on arrival. Driving a rental truck yourself puts the schedule entirely in your hands.
